我目前正在jQuery的文档就绪事件处理程序中保存一个cookie,如:
$(function() {
document.cookie = <cookie with info not dependent on DOM>
});
甚至更早保存cookie是否可行且安全,例如作为在解释JavaScript文件时执行的任何事件处理程序之外的JavaScript语句?任何可能不可靠的浏览器?
答案 0 :(得分:1)
如果您不依赖于DOM的值,那么在DOM完成加载之前读取和写入cookie是100%正确的。如果您使用Chrome的Ghostery扩展程序并转到任何网站,您可以查看在DOM准备好之前加载的跟踪标记,其中大多数将使用普通的Cookie,这将让您了解它的常见程度这样做。